Front Seat Head Restraint problem #1

I have recently purchased a 2005 mercedes g-55 which had an aftermarket dvd system with screens in both front headrests. Upon removing the headrests to install seat covers, we discovered the dvd installer had cut into the headrest posts, thusly ruining the integrity of the headrests. I have ordered new headrests from mercedes 6 weeks ago. We believe this is a serious safety hazard and also fear that many aftermarket dvd system installers may be cutting the headrest posts and the consumer is completely unaware of the damage done to their headrests and the integrity that is lost. As we all know headrests are an important safety feature in modern automobiles and have saved countless lives and lessened the likelihood of whiplash, head and neck injury. We plan to retain the old, altered headrests until we are satisfied this problem is addressed. I have been in the automotive trade for 31 years and do have an understanding of safety, integrity and the consequence of alterations such as this. Thank-you.
